Maybe it's just me? I wouldn't swap any of our cup record. I think we have created 12 upsets in 11 years in the lower leagues. Two semis at Hampden plus a replay. Beating Celtic twice. The first time was 10 years before Cownty and it was our first ever season in div 1. More wins at Tynecastle, Fir Park etc. Coming from 3 down to beat Ayr. Reaching the quarters as a div 3 side. Taking DUFC to 210 mins as a div 2 side. Swap all this for what? One cup run beating Hibs and Celtic to reach a final, and then forgetting to turn up.1 point

Personally though Shane put in a great shift in when he replaced Billy. Chased every loose ball. Id go as far as saying he helped us seal the game, in a way in which Billy couldnt. He was a great out ball, big deal he missed a chance, Billy's missed plenty chances, and anyway he created the chance himself. Give the players a fecking break just once. Thats the second time ive seen Shane play up top off the bench this season, the first been against Aberdeen when he came on won a penalty, created a couple chances and then got injured, and thats the second time hes had a positive impact. wouldnt surprise me at all if we see Terry using him more often to ease pressure at the end of games. He was the best outball we had on saturday, with the pitch being poor and having to resort to the longball often. The highlights showed his miss but what they didnt show was the linking with A.Shinnie and Nick Ross, and the corners/throw ins he won. At this level players miss chances. Fact!1 point
